site stats

Group by and get list pandas

WebSep 5, 2024 · Thanks @WillAyd @TomAugspurger for the comment. My understanding is groupby() and get_group() are reciprocal operations:. df.groupby(): from dataframe to grouping grp.get_group(): from grouping to dataframe Since it's common to call groupby() once and get multiple groupings out of a single dataframe (operation "one-df-to-many … WebAug 5,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

Pandas groupby () and count () with Examples

WebSep 15, 2024 · We can use groupby () method on column 1 and apply the method to apply a list on every group of pandas DataFrame. Python3 import pandas as pd df = pd.DataFrame ( {'column1': ['A', 'B', 'C', 'A', 'C', … WebPandas GroupBy.apply method duplicates first group Question: My first SO question: I am confused about this behavior of apply method of groupby in pandas (0.12.0-4), it appears to apply the function TWICE to the first row of a data frame. For example: >>> from pandas import Series, DataFrame >>> import pandas as pd >>> df … dji agri drone https://ironsmithdesign.com

python - 如何在python中使用for循環創建多個數據幀 - 堆棧內存溢出

WebApr 6, 2024 · Get Indexes of a Pandas DataFrames in array format. We can get the indexes of a DataFrame or dataset in the array format using “ index.values “. Here, the below code will return the indexes that are from 0 to 9 for the Pandas DataFrame we have created, in … WebAug 17, 2024 · Pandas groupby () on Two or More Columns. Most of the time we would need to perform groupby on multiple columns of DataFrame, you can do this by passing a list of column labels you wanted to perform … WebMar 14, 2024 · Note that the head() function only displays the first 5 values by group. To display the top n values by group, simply use head(n) instead. Note: You can find the complete documentation for the GroupBy operation in pandas here. Additional Resources. The following tutorials explain how to perform other common operations in pandas: dji agriculture

Modify get_group() method to allow getting multiple groups #28298 - Github

Category:All Pandas groupby() you should know for grouping data and performing

Tags:Group by and get list pandas

Group by and get list pandas

Pandas GroupBy: Group, Summarize, and Aggregate Data …

WebMar 14, 2024 · Method 1: Group Rows into List for One Column df.groupby('group_var') ['values_var'].agg(list).reset_index(name='values_var') Method 2: Group Rows into List … WebDec 20, 2024 · The Pandas .groupby () method allows you to aggregate, transform, and filter DataFrames. The method works by using split, transform, and apply operations. You can group data by multiple …

Group by and get list pandas

Did you know?

WebOct 28, 2024 · My final goal is to have data in a list like below: [[5,6,7],[5]] (this is for id 1 grouped by the id and year) [[3],[3],[4,5]] (this is for id 2 grouped by the id and year) [[3],[6]] (same logic as above) I have grouped the data using df.groupby(['id', 'year']). But after … WebMar 14, 2024 · Example 1: Group Rows into List for One Column. We can use the following syntax to group rows by the team column and product one list for the values in the points column: #group points values into list by team df.groupby('team') ['points'].agg(list).reset_index(name='points') team points 0 A [10, 10, 12, 15] 1 B [19, …

Web如果我理解正確,您可以為此使用list理解:. subset_df_list = [df.groupby('Location').get_group(36) for df in df_list] 順便說一句,您的for循環不起作用,因為您只是繼續分配回df 。 您可能需要這樣做,這也等同於上述理解: WebGroup Series using a mapper or by a Series of columns. A groupby operation involves some combination of splitting the object, applying a function, and combining the results. This can be used to group large amounts of data and compute operations on these groups. Parameters. bymapping, function, label, or list of labels.

WebJan 26, 2024 · The below example does the grouping on Courses column and calculates count how many times each value is present. # Using groupby () and count () df2 = df. groupby (['Courses'])['Courses']. count () print( df2) Yields below output. Courses Hadoop 2 Pandas 1 PySpark 1 Python 2 Spark 2 Name: Courses, dtype: int64. WebAug 5,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and …

WebAug 29, 2024 · Pandas Groupby is used in situations where we want to split data and set into groups so that we can do various operations on those groups like – Aggregation of data, Transformation through some group …

WebMay 11, 2024 · A column or list of columns; A dict or pandas Series; A NumPy array or pandas Index, or an array-like iterable of these; You can take advantage of the last option in order to group by the day of the … dji agro droneWebMar 31, 2024 · Pandas dataframe.groupby () Pandas dataframe.groupby () function is used to split the data into groups based on some criteria. Pandas objects can be split on any of their axes. The abstract definition of … dji agroWebCompute min of group values. GroupBy.ngroup ( [ascending]) Number each group from 0 to the number of groups - 1. GroupBy.nth. Take the nth row from each group if n is an int, otherwise a subset of rows. GroupBy.ohlc () Compute open, high, low and close values of a group, excluding missing values. dji ai stockWebMar 13, 2024 · 1. What is Pandas groupby() and how to access groups information?. The role of groupby() is anytime we want to analyze data by some categories. The simplest call must have a column name. In our … dji aguriWebDataFrameGroupBy.aggregate(func=None, *args, engine=None, engine_kwargs=None, **kwargs) [source] #. Aggregate using one or more operations over the specified axis. Function to use for aggregating the data. If a function, must either work when passed a DataFrame or when passed to DataFrame.apply. dji air 2 alternativeWebMar 13, 2024 · Groupby () is a powerful function in pandas that allows you to group data based on a single column or more. You can apply many operations to a groupby object, including aggregation functions like sum (), mean (), and count (), as well as lambda function and other custom functions using apply (). The resulting output of a groupby () operation ... dji aimedji aio